Undisclosed Fees Awareness
Frequently ignored, hidden fees can considerably impact the final cost of boat rentals for events. Renters may encounter charges such as fuel surcharges, cleaning fees, and security deposits that can accumulate rapidly. Moreover, some companies apply fees for late returns or insurance coverage, which can considerably elevate the final bill. To avoid unexpected costs, it is vital for individuals to comprehensively assess rental agreements and ask questions upfront. A complete breakdown of costs can help uncover potential hidden fees, permitting more accurate budgeting. What's the Standard Capacity of Boats Available for Rental?
Standard boat rental capacities vary considerably, accommodating from two to twelve passengers for compact vessels, while larger yachts can accommodate up to 50 or more, depending on the type and purpose of the rental.

What's the Recommended Booking Timeline for a Boat Rental?
It is generally advisable to book a boat rental no less than 2-4 weeks in advance. This ensures greater availability, especially during popular seasons, providing a suitable vessel for the scheduled event.
